Python-bsblan

Latest version: v1.2.1

Safety actively analyzes 723144 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 3 of 16

1.2.1

What’s changed

🐛 Bug fixes

- Refactor get_temperature_unit method to a property liudger (1000)

1.2.0

What’s changed

🚀 Enhancements

- Add asynchronous method to retrieve temperature unit in BSBLAN class liudger (999)

1.1

ATTENTION: The next release will contain several fundamental changes which will break some of the configurations, so that an update WILL require you to adjust your settings! If the current Master branch version is not working for you, try this one here. Also, Mega2560 users should still be able to run this version if not all modules are activated:

- ATTENTION: DHW Push ("Trinkwasser Push") parameter had to be moved from 1601 to 1603 because 1601 has a different "official" meaning on some heaters. Please check and change your configuration if necessary
- ATTENTION: New categories added, most category numbers (using /K) will be shifted up by a few numbers.
- /JA URL command outputs average values
- Many new parameters decoded
- New parameters for device families 25, 44, 51, 59, 68, 85, 88, 90, 96, 97, 108, 134, 162, 163, 170, 195, 209, 211
- Improved mobile display of webinterface
- Added definement "BtSerial" for diverting serial output to Serial2 where a Bluetooth adapter can be connected (5V->5V, GND->GND, RX->TX2, TX->RX2). Adapter has to be in slave mode and configured to 115200 bps, 8N1.
- Lots of added Polish translations
- New data types VT_BYTE10, VT_SPF
- Bugfix for PPS bus regarding display of heating time programs
- Bugfix for MQTT

1.1.0

What’s changed

✨ New features

- Enhance handling type conversion in models liudger (998)

🚀 Enhancements

- Enhance handling type conversion in models liudger (998)

1.0

ATTENTION: Next release will include new categories (and therefore a shift in category numbers) and also move the DHW Push parameter from 1601 to 1603. If you are installing BSB-LAN for the first time, please get the most recent code from the master repository to avoid making these changes with your next update.

- /JI URL command outputs configuration in JSON structure
- /JC URL command gets list of possible values from user-defined list of functions. Example: /JC=505,700,701,702,711,1600,1602
- Logging telegrams (log parameter 30000) now writes to separate file (journal.txt). It can be reset with /D0 (same time with datalog.txt) command and dumped with /DJ command.
- removed WIFI configuration as it is no longer applicable for the Due
- lots of new parameters for various device families
- Code optimization and restructuring, general increase of speed
- new schemativs for board layout V3
- lots of bugfixes

1.0.0

What’s changed

- Update LICENSE.md liudger (993)
- Bugfix/license fix liudger (994)

✨ New features

- Refactor validation of parameters on bsblan device API calls liudger (995)

🚀 Enhancements

- Refactor validation of parameters on bsblan device API calls liudger (995)

⬆️ Dependency updates

- ⬆️ Update dependency yarl to v1.17.1 renovate (996)
- ⬆️ Update pypa/gh-action-pypi-publish action to v1.11.0 renovate (997)

Page 3 of 16

© 2025 Safety CLI Cybersecurity Inc. All Rights Reserved.